So since the deciding factor for at least a handful of people on here has been the lack of light throw to the sides, I'll touch on that, again with the context being that I have never had HIDs and I'm only able to test these on small urban streets with street lights, granted it's not like downtown where EVERYTHING is lit up; just typical residential neighborhood lighting:
I see no concerning discernible difference between these and OEM. The light pattern throws all the way to either side of the windshield and I can
easily see what's on the perpendicular streets when I am driving up to them. I can see a gap of light at the bottom corners of the windshield where the obvious beam pattern cuts off at an angle, but that area does nothing besides show what's five to ten feet in front of my tires. This gap is easily mitigated by fog lights. I never plan to run anything but street-legal fog lights, so I have no mind running them on roads if I'm out in the sticks and determine that I need that gap filled in. But I really don't see the issue with them that other people have brought up. Of course, that could be for a variety of reasons.
